Vacuum leaks are easy to find, use something flammable, eh, ‘brake cleaner’ or ‘start ya bastard’ engine should rev up slightly/ping if a leak is present when you spray the vacuum lines.

No need to get under the car at all, that sh*ts for amatures. Take the airbox and intake pipe off to where it joins the pipe over the engine (FG), once airbox is removed the oil filter is right there and you can reach the sump plug by reaching down the side of the engine and over the K-frame. 15mm spanner = happy days, job done, no rolling on the floor for me ??
